php实现json编码的方法


  本文标签:php,json编码

本文实例讲述了php实现json编码的方法 。分享给大家供大家参考 。具体如下:

<?php
/*
 * json
 */
$books = array(key1=>value1,key2=>value2,key3=>array(key4=>value4,key5=>value5));
$json = json_encode($books);
$rejson = json_decode($json,true);
echo 原数组:<br/>;
print_r($books);
echo <br/><br/>;
echo 经json编码后:<br/>;
print $json."<br/>";
echo <br/>;
echo 经json解码后:<br/>;
print_r($rejson);
echo <br/><br/>;
//实例
$jsonn = {"error_code":"400","request":"\/Router\/aQConnectError","api_code":40006,"error":"\u4f20\u5165\u7684\u63a5\u53e3\u53c2\u6570\u51fa\u9519\uff0c\u53c2\u6570openid\u672a\u8bbe\u5b9a\u3002"};
print_r(json_decode($jsonn));
?>

希望本文所述对大家的php程序设计有所帮助 。